Genomics

is a rapidly evolving field that requires specialized skills and knowledge. This Certificate in Genomics Research Methods is designed for researchers and scientists who want to gain a deeper understanding of genomics techniques and applications.

The course covers the fundamental principles of genomics, including DNA sequencing, gene expression analysis, and genome assembly. It also explores advanced topics such as next-generation sequencing, bioinformatics, and genomics data analysis.

Through a combination of online lectures, practical exercises, and case studies, learners will develop the skills and knowledge needed to design and conduct genomics research projects.

By the end of the course, learners will be able to apply genomics research methods to real-world problems and contribute to the advancement of the field.
